The Perryville Police Department’s Juvenile Outreach Program was developed in 2006 as an innovative and comprehensive program to serve local youth ages 8-18. The Outreach Program is the first of its kind in Cecil County and provides an opportunity for low-income youth in our community to foster relationships with police officers and provide recreational sports and enrichment programs free of charge to the youth in our community. The Perryville Police Department Juvenile Outreach Program receives referrals from the Perryville Police Department for youth that would benefit by engaging in community service and life skills classes instead of being sent into the Juvenile Justice System.
